    The two best years/team we had we ended up losing to Ottawa in the final in overtime (still get upset over Galbraith cheapshot to deliberatly injure Brad Stuart the game after doing the same to Cheechoo) and then getting upset by Dan Blackburn in one of the best goaltending exhibition I've ever witnessed. The second team was the best, ranked #1 from pre-season and every week after that, and our longest winless streak was one game until Blackburn stoned us. And I do believe we have had 12 players on that squard play in the NHL. Some for only a cup of coffee but others a bit longer with Stuart probably doing the best.
    Will this team be as good is a good question. It has the possibilities to be with a better defensive squard but not as much offense. We won't have a 60 goal scorer or 120 point man but who does nowadays? Maybe a more balance squard this year and more overall speed.
    And we will have a couple more players added to this team through trades before Kisio is done.
